Link2SD: Einrichtung und Probleme

  • 2.016 Antworten
  • Letztes Antwortdatum
@ Android:
Als Alternativtool wollte ich Apps2SD testen - soll ja auch mit Android 5.0 gehen, womit Link2SD noch Probleme hat, also gehe ich von etwas anderer Funktionsweise aus.

Zu den anderen Punkten:
- Würde die ext4-Partition nicht funktionieren, würde Link2SD nicht spätestens beim Erstellen der Mount-Skripte meckern? Und wäre die ext4-Partition nicht komplett leer?
- Vor dem Wechsel auf die 16GByte-MicroSD-Karte war eine 4GByte-Karte von einem völlig anderen Hersteller im Gerät - mit dem gleichen Problem. Inkompatibilitäten zur MicroSD-Karte schließe ich daher aus.

Klar, Fakt bleibt, dass es dennoch nicht funktioniert. Kann mir jemand sagen, wie man sich Logfiles bzgl. Link2SD anzeigen lassen kann?
 
Habe es weiter untersucht - und jetzt wird es mysteriös: Über den ES Datei Explorer habe ich herausgefunden, dass die ext4-Partition viele leere Android-Standard-Verzeichnisse wie DCIM, Pictures, Ringtones enthält. Und nach dem Entfernen der Links über Link2SD wird viel noch zu viel Platzbedarf angezeigt.
Ich habe dann die ext4-Partition unter Windows gelöscht (MiniTool Partition Wizard), den freien Platz der fat32-Partition zugewiesen und den freien Speicher mit H2testw überprüft. Zumindest dort keine Fehler (wobei ja eigentlich die Partitionsinfos am Anfang stehen...).
Dann den fat32-Bereich gesichert, die Karte komplett mit dem MiniTool Partition Wizard platt gemacht, neu partitioniert und das Backup zurückgespielt.

Beim ersten Start hat mir der ES Datei Explorer 3 (!) Partitionen angezeigt: sdcard0 mit 12,37 GByte, sdext2 mit 2,28 GByte und sdcard1 mit 2,33 GByte (Partition Wizard: 12,39 und 2,44). Dann habe ich die Mount-Skripte neu erstellen lassen, und nach dem Neustart waren es dann nur noch 2 Partitionen. Allerdings wird für die leere ext4-Partition bereits jetzt ein Platzbedarf von 1,81 GByte von 2,33 GByte angezeigt. Laut Android System Info waren die Mountpoints und ihre Parameter in beiden Fällen identisch!

Das Verlinken von 10-20 App geht trotzdem, ein Zugriff auf die ext4-Partition scheint also möglich, ansonsten hätte ich gleich zu Beginn Fehlermeldungen sowie die ganze Zeit vorher über Abstürze erwartet. Auch ext2 statt ext4 half nichts.

Was kann jetzt der Grund sein?
- Partitioniert der Partition Wizard unzuverlässig? Würde es ggf. nochmal mit gparted Live probieren
- Inkompatibilitäten mit der SD-Karte (Class 10)? Auf dem PC keine Probleme, und der grundsätzliche Zugriff zumindest auf die fat32-Partition funktioniert ja anscheinened. Ich kann den Test mit h2testw auch nochmal über die gesamte Karte laufen lassen - aber das ist eben auf dem PC.
- Firmware-Fehler - warum gibt es diese Standard-Ordner der fat32-Partition auch in der ext4-Partition?
- Link2SD-Fehler - stimmt was bei der Initialisierung/dem Mounten der ext4-Partition nicht?
(- Hardware-Fehler: Unser Wiko Lenny bringt beim SD-Zugriff irgendetwas durcheinander)

Daher die Fragen:
- Hat jemand von Euch Link2SD auf einem Wiko Lenny zuverlässig am Laufen?
- Hat noch jemand schonmal ähnliche Probleme mit SD-Karten bei bestimmten Smartphones erlebt? Gibt es ein Tool, um das Zusammenspiel Smartphone-SD-Karte zuverlässig zu überprüfen?

Und schließlich: Kann man den Hersteller (in diesem Fall speziell Wiko) mit so etwas belästigen? Rooten wird ja "nicht gerne gesehen", aber Link2SD funktioniert halt nicht ohne, und aktuell geht für mich das Lenny in den Bereich "unbrauchbar".
 
Es wird Dir so gar nichts helfen, wenn Du den Support von irgendeinem großen Hersteller wegen Deiner privaten Softwareprobleme kontaktierst. Das sind "liebe" (im Sinne von geduldig und hart im nehmen), nette, von einer Drittfirma auf Teilzeitbasis angestellte Produkt-Laien die eine riesige Checkliste rund um das jeweilige Produkt vor sich am Bildschirm haben, aber weder Techniker, noch Softwareentwickler und auch keine Tüftler (von privat engagierten Ausnahmen mal abgesehen) sind. Was also soll das bringen, wenn Du die dann auch noch zu einem fremden Produkt befragst? :rolleyes:

Also beginn ganz bei Null, und damit meine ich, dass Du einen factory reset machst, die virtuelle, also interne Speicherkarte formatierst, die Partitionen der realen, also externen Speicherkarte neu anlegst (das kann man auch über ein Live-Linux erledigen) und natürlich KEIN Backup einspielst. Und sollte Dein OS natives App2SD und / oder das vertauschte Einbinden der Speicherkarten unterstützen, lässt Du davon bitte die Finger; sonst wird das nichts!
 
Hallo zusammen,

ich habe mein Handy Xperia L mit Link2SD versehen. Bootloop-Problem aufgrund init.d konnte ich lösen.
Nun das Problem: die EXT2-Partition wird erkannt und kann genutzt werden. Alles wurde darauf verschoben, wie geplant.
Leider wird die FAT32 offenbar nicht erkannt. Ich kann sie formatieren, allerdings offenbar ohne Effekt. Android will sie auch nach dem formatieren immer wieder nur formatieren, aber nicht mounten.

1. Wie bekomme ich das hin
2. WOFÜR überhaupt die FAT32-Partition? Könnte ich nicht einfach 16 GB EXT2 anlegen?
3. Wenn ich die Karte neu formatieren wollte (also am PC), müsste ich vorher alle Apps wieder auf intern verschieben, korrekt? Wenn ich das nicht mache, wird das System dann sehr instabil oder verkraftet Android das (habe fast alles verschoben, was ging)?
 
Eine Frage von mir . Kann man Apps komplett auf die SD Karte überragen ohne das etwas auf den Gerätespeicher zurück bleibt?? Wenn ja ,wie mache ich das???? Ich kann die Apps zwar verschieben aber es bleibt immer etwas auf den Gerät zurück und irgendwann wird dadurch der Speicher voll
Es wäre super wenn es ein Lösung geben würde ...... Danke schon mal im voraus..
 
Wenn man die kostenpflichtige "Plus"-Version von Link2SD nimmt, kann man ohne zusätzliche Apps auch die Daten der Apps auf die Speicherkarte verbannen.


@Andr_21: Wenn die erste Partition der Speicherkarte auch tatsächlich eine primäre Partition ist, und davor und dahinter kein unpartitionierter Bereich ist, sollte eigentlich alles klappen. FAT32 ist einfach der Android-Standard für die Speicherkarte (schlicht weil jede Betriebssystemwelt damit umgehen kann) und wird daher auch von jeder App erwartet. Klar kannst Du, so Dein OS und Du selbst damit klar kommst, natürlich auch jedes andere unterstützte Dateisystem (wie eben ext2 das eben in der Linux-Welt standardmäßig unterstützt wird) verwenden.

Und nein, wenn man eine Partition erneut formatiert braucht man die andern deswegen nicht anzufassen; das ist doch der Sinn von Partitionen! Du räumst doch auch nicht das Schlafzimmer aus, bloß weil Du im Wohnzimmer ausmalen willst. ;)
 
Zuletzt bearbeitet:
@Mane261
Deine Frage hat hier mit dem Thema absolut überhaupt nichts zu tun und gehört somit auch nicht hier rein! Solltest eigentlich lange genug hier dabei sein und somit auch das wissen können:
Ja, man kann Grundsätzlich auch die anderen App Daten auf die SD Karte auslagern, bzw. direkt dahin verschieben, setzt aber zumindest root vorraus!
Gruß,

snoopy-1
 
  • Danke
Reaktionen: email.filtering
Mein Handy war nicht dazu zu bewegen, mit Link2SD zu arbeiten, wenn ich nach den Standard-Anleitungen vorging.
Ich habe dann statt der FAT32-Partition eine NTFS angelegt und zusätzlich die Paragon NTFS-App installiert. Nun läuft es :)
 
Hallo zusammen,
Ich versuche link2sd zu installieren.

Hab die anleitungen zu dem thema bei xda gelesen. Bisher gab jedes mal bootloop.

Egal welches datei system. Ext2 oder fat32.
Egal ob primaere Partition oder logisch.

Auch mit init.d funktioniert es nicht.

Wenn ich das Handy starte und den bootloop bekomme ist jedes mal die zweite Partition Schrott.

Was kann ich noch tun um mein eigentliches Problem zu loesen

Kein Speicher mehr fuer apps.
 
Ich kapiere es nicht: User nehmen eine Anleitung von irgendwo aus dem WWW und wenn es schief läuft sollen wir dann helfen. Immer das gleiche.

Wir haben selbst eine deutsche umfangreiche Anleitung zu Link2SD. Siehe Link2SD einrichten – Android Wiki

Und bei neueren Geräten empfiehlt sich Ext4 als 2.Partition
 
Danke das du auf einen Teil meiner Fragestellungen eingehst. Jedoch nachdem Link2sd das mountscript erstellt und neu startet kommt es zum bootloop.
Eine Xperia Eigenheiten vermutlich weil intern bereits eine sd Karte verbaut ist...
 
Handy ist Xperia L
 
Über eine virtuelle, also interne Speicherkarte verfügt de facto jedes Gerät aus dem letzten drei Jahren, und dennoch funktioniert auch bei diesen das Auslagern von Apps und deren Daten auf die reale, also externe Speicherkarte. Daran kann es also nicht liegen, wenn es mit Link2SD bei Deinem Gerät nicht klappt. ;)

Schnapp Dir also einfach mal Deine Speicherkarte, das Gerät und eine Anleitung aus unserem Forum und geh das ganze noch mal durch!

Dass man alle anderen, allenfalls auch nativ angebotenen Möglichkeiten zur Speicherverwaltung (wie z.B. das vertauschte Einbinden der Speicherkarten, App2SD usw. ) links liegen lassen sollte wenn man Link2SD einsetzen will, sollte klar sein, denn die beißen sich gegenseitig.
 
Cool: jetzt habe ich gerade Update von CM12 auf 12.1 geflasht, danach das Skript das mir Link2SD gleich anbot geflasht und alle Apps waren brav wieder da!
Musste nichts neu installieren oder verschieben.
Zuerst hatte es zwar nicht geklappt weil ich vergessen hatte dass ich ext4 und nicht ext2 hatte ("Skript konnte nicht erstellt werden") aber dann ging es mit ext4.
 
Ihr Lieben,

ich weis leider nicht warum mein Post gelöscht wurde, das Problem war ja noch nicht ganz behoben,
deshalb versuche ich es nochmals. Das Handy (S5360) ist gerootet und Link2sd ist aufgespielt.
Nun habe ich aber dennoch das Problem, dass ich nicht auf die SD-karte packen kann da ich nur vorinstallierte Apps auf dem Handy habe, keine runtergeladene. Ich kann also nichts verschieben um Platz zu schaffen. Kann ich nun irgendwo eingeben das ich die Sd-Karte als bevorzugten Speicherplatz nutzen möchte statt den Telefonspeicher?

Kann mir da nochmals jemand helfen?

Vielen, vielen Dank!
 
Da unterliegst Du schon mal einem Irrtum, denn jedes Update oder Upgrade einer vorinstallierten App liegt wie jede andere App auch in der Datenpartition und kann von dort auf die Speicherkarte ausgelagert, oder noch besser, gleich in die Systempartition integriert werden (so lange dort noch ausreichend Speicherplatz dafür vorhanden ist). ;)

Selbstverständlich kannst Du Link2SD so konfigurieren, dass künftig alle Apps automatisch ausgelagert werden. Allerdings belegt ja nicht nur die App selbst Speicherplatz in der Datenpartition, sondern auch deren Daten sowie die Datenbanken mit Deinen Inhalten. Und um auch diese auf die Speicherkarte verbannen zu können, benötigst Du die kostenpflichtige Plus-Version von Link2SD.

Zudem kann man bei den Einstellungen der einen oder anderen App festlegen, wo deren Daten abgelegt werden sollen. Doch das ändert nichts daran, dass die Datenpartition ja nicht umsonst so heißt. :winki:

Ach ja, und Deine ersten Beiträge wurden nicht gelöscht, sondern lediglich in jenen Thread verschoben, den Du bei einer (sinnvollen) Nutzung der Forensuche auch selbst gefunden hättest. Also guck einfach mal in Dein Postfach oder Profil, wenn Du nicht weißt, wo das Zeug abgeblieben ist.
 
Zuletzt bearbeitet:
Und außerdem kannst du mit Link2SD auch ungewünschte Vorinstallierte Apps auch deinstallieren und damit für immer vom Gerät verbannen. Nur der dadurch entstandene Speicherplatz kann leider nicht für neue Apps verwendet werden.
 

Ähnliche Themen

D
Antworten
0
Aufrufe
148
Daniel Albert
D
W
Antworten
1
Aufrufe
95
Klaus986
K
D
Antworten
0
Aufrufe
52
Daniel Albert
D
Zurück
Oben Unten